The life cycle cost where estimated based off reducing 1 lane of pavement for the length of Waco Street(0.134 <br /> miles; 911 square yards). The table below summarizes life cycle cost factors used to determine the overall life cycle <br /> cost savings. <br /> Summary of Life Cycle Treatment Costs <br /> Treatment Units Cost/Unit Treatment Cost Treatment Years <br /> i <br /> Rejuvenator 911 SY $ 1.11 /SY $ 1,007.3 8 11 21, 41 <br /> Crack Seal 911 SY $ 0.57/SY $ 519.27 31 71 141 231 271 34,43147154 <br /> 2"Mill & Overlay 911 SY $11.11 / SY Is 10,124.73 20, 40 <br /> Snow Events 78 <br /> Annual 0.1335 Ln Mi $ 684.41 /Ln Mi $ 91.3 8 Annual <br /> Salt Events (8 <br /> Annual) 0.1335 Ln Mi $ 740.10/Ln M1 $ 9 8.82 Annual <br /> Per the estimated costs,the additional up-front costs minus the life cycle cost savings to reduce the width of Waco <br /> Street is an additional $23,500 - $46,000 than option 1, which is reconstructing Waco Street to its existing width. <br /> The additional up-front cost of$86,141.82 is a 15-percent increase to the overall project costs. <br /> Notification: <br /> Notifications are not required for this case. <br /> Observations/Alternatives: <br /> Motion to adopt Resolution#21-345 authorizing reconstruction of Waco Street to the existing pavement width as <br /> part of Improvement Project#22-01. <br /> Recommendation: <br /> Staff recommends adopting Resolution#21-345 authorizing reconstruction of Waco Street to its existing pavement <br /> width as part of Improvement Project#22-01. The additional cost of reducing the width of Waco Street from 46' to <br /> 34' will have an estimated up-front cost of$86,141.82,which is a 15-percent increase to the estimated project <br /> costs. Estimated life cycle costs will not result in a net overall savings over the estimated life of the improvements, <br /> falling$23,500 to $46,000 short of the up-front cost.
